How you'll make an impact in this role
  • Execute Targeted Claims Management & Follow-up: Work and resolve aged, denied, or unpaid claims, conducting thorough root-cause analysis to secure proper reimbursement from payors.

  • Resolve Missing Slips & Clinical Documentation: Track down, audit, and reconcile missing charge slips and incomplete billing documentation to ensure all clinical services are promptly billed and unbilled revenue is minimized.

  • Master High-Priority Workqueues & Documentation Reports: Monitor, analyze, and clear specialized daily tracking tools-including 3 and 5 Doc reports-to drive strict compliance and prevent billing backlogs.

  • Drive Financial Account Reconciliation: Assist the billing team with daily and monthly financial reconciliations, auditing patient accounts, verifying ledger entries, and resolving balancing discrepancies.

  • Maintain Meticulous Account Integrity: Document all claim actions, provider outreach, and payment reconciliations within the billing system with exceptional precision.

  • Optimize Daily Revenue Workflow: Leverage strong time management to prioritize competing daily tasks, balancing claims processing, documentation tracking, and account auditing seamlessly.

What minimum qualifications you'll need

Education:

  • High School diploma equivalency OR 1 year of applicable cumulative job specific experience required.
    • Note: Required professional licensure/certification can be used in lieu of education or experience, if applicable.
What additional requirements you'll need
  • Medical Billing Experience Required: Direct background working in healthcare billing, claims processing, or revenue cycle operations, with a firm understanding of EOBs, claim denials, and charge entries.

  • Sharp Attention to Detail: Exceptional precision when auditing financial reports, identifying missing charge documentation, and reconciling complex patient accounts.

  • Proven Time Management & Prioritization: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age time-sensitive reports (such as 3 and 5 Doc queues) and execute daily worklists without missing deadlines.

  • Problem-Solving Agility: Ability to investigate missing information, communicate cross-functionally with clinical departments, and resolve billing holds efficiently.

  • Technical System Competency: Proficient in navigating Electronic Health Record (EHR) systems, medical billing software, and financial tracking platforms.
